Mwakwe Surname Meaning

User-submitted Reference

The Mwakwe surname originates from an ancient title given to any great warror within the Bamasaba or Bagisu in Bantu ethnic group, who could fight and defend the community from dangerous animals. It means 'great hunter'. It came from the Lugisu word ingwe, meaning 'Leopard'. This surname currently belongs to the Bugisu clan Bamasokho.

How Common Is The Last Name Mwakwe? popularity and diffusion

Mwakwe is the 1,894,523rd most commonly used last name on a worldwide basis, borne by around 1 in 75,911,937 people. This surname occurs mostly in Africa, where 100 percent of Mwakwe are found; 95 percent are found in East Africa and 50 percent are found in East Bantu Africa.

The last name Mwakwe is most commonly used in Uganda, where it is borne by 89 people, or 1 in 438,644. In Uganda it is most numerous in: Manafwa District, where 36 percent live, Bulambuli District, where 18 percent live and Mbale District, where 12 percent live. Not including Uganda it is found in 3 countries. It also occurs in Zambia, where 5 percent live and Kenya, where 1 percent live.
